Trump says he might give federal coronavirus aid to states if they comply with his political demands

Donald Trump tweeted on Tuesday that federal aid to states battling the novel coronavirus may depend on those states eliminating sanctuary cities, payroll taxes, and capital-gains taxes.

"Well run States should not be bailing out poorly run States, using CoronaVirus as the excuse!" the president tweeted. "The elimination of Sanctuary Cities, Payroll Taxes, and perhaps Capital Gains Taxes, must be put on the table. Also lawsuit indemnification & business deductions for restaurants & ent."

This isn't the first time Trump has implied he may link government aid to states complying with his hard-line immigration demands.

"I don't think you should have sanctuary cities if they get that kind of aid. If you're going to get aid to the cities and states for the kind of numbers you're talking about, billions of dollars, I don't think you should have sanctuary cities," he said on Wednesday.

https://news.yahoo.com/trump-says-might-condition-federal-201032305.html
